The Talonsoft games have a feature that "highlights" certain troops after selecting a button. For example, it will highlight all troops not fired yet, or all troops within one unit, etc. They are potentially useful aids....

...but I can barely see the "highlight." One - I am color blind. Two - the screen resolution on today's computers is much higher than when the game was first made....such that the "highlighted" portion of the icon is now only a slim sliver of color change. I do recall that these were more readable back in the 1990s when I first played these games.

These "highlight" aids are useless to me and I never use them.....but would like to use them.

Has anybody worked on a mod to fix the "highlighting?"

I see that there are .bmp files with lots of icon details......was wondering if they can be modified? If so, anybody figure out which ones to modify?

Tom e-mailed me his mod, but in his e-mail he corrected that the mod is for HPS Gettysburg, not the Talonsoft games.

BUT....I did find "simovitch's graphics mods for John Tiller's Battleground Civil War, January 2010"

simovitch's mod changes the color of the bases of the units in the zoomed-in 3D view. I went in and changed the color for the zoomed-in 2D view by adding a yellow dot to the 2D icons (I typically only use the 2D view). The highlighting should work for when selecting unit organization, units fired, units fixed, etc. The Zoomed-out 3D and zoomed-out 2D have not been changed...though they can be, if anybody want to mod those icons.
